Cで可能な数のセットのすべての可能な組み合わせをどのように生成しますか?

質問者:Pinkie Jelvakov |最終更新日:2020年6月27日
カテゴリ:科学物理学
4.1 / 5 (1,398ビュー。26投票)
与えられた数のリストのすべての可能な組み合わせを生成するCプログラム
  1. #include <stdio.h>
  2. #include <string.h>
  3. #define N10。
  4. void print(int * num、int n)
  5. int i;
  6. for(i = 0; i <n; i ++)
  7. printf( "%d"、num [i]);
  8. printf( "");

この点で、一連の数字のすべての組み合わせをどのように見つけますか?

組み合わせは、結果の順序が重要ではないイベントの合計結果を計算する方法です。組み合わせを計算するには、式nCr = n!を使用します。 / NS! *(N - R)]ここで、nアイテムの合計数を表し、そしてRは、一度に選択されるアイテムの数を表します。

3579のすべての可能な組み合わせは何ですか? 4つあります! =合計24の組み合わせ。各桁を別々に見てみましょう。たとえば、数字9は、4つの異なる位置に配置できます。

同様に、1234のすべての組み合わせは何ですか?

あなたが箱入り1234に賭けている場合は、次の組み合わせのいずれかが描かれた場合に勝つ:1234、1243、1324、1342、1423、1432、2134、2143、2314、2341、2413、2431、3124、3142、3214、3241 、3412、3421、4123、4132、4213、4231、4312、または4321。

3456のすべての可能な組み合わせは何ですか?

次に、因子のすべての異なる組み合わせをペアにして、 3456のすべての因子ペアを取得します。 3456の係数は、 1、2、3、4、6、8、9、12、16、18、24、27、32、36、48、54、64、72、96、108、128、144、192です。 、 216、288、384、432、576、864、1152、1728 、および3456

33関連する質問の回答が見つかりました

4つの組み合わせはいくつありますか?

あなたは乗算一緒にこれらの選択肢は、あなたの結果を得るために:×2×3 4(×1)= 24組合せおよび順列は、多くの場合、学生が混乱している-それらが関連しているが、彼らは別のものを意味し、状況の全く異なる解釈につながることができますし、質問。

3つの数字09の可能なすべての組み合わせは何ですか?

あなたが実際に望んでいるのがあなたが言ったこと、つまり組み合わせであるなら、それはまったく異なるものです。順序が重要ではない10桁のうち3桁を選択する方法の数です。 3桁を連続して並べ替えるには、6 = 3x2x1の方法があります。したがって、10桁のうち3つ組み合わせの数は720/6 = 120の組み合わせです。

電卓にはいくつの組み合わせがありますか?

組み合わせおよび順列計算機を使用してこの問題を解決するには、次のようにします。
  • 分析目標として「順列のカウント」を選択します。
  • 「セット内のサンプルポイント数」に「7」を入力します。
  • 「各順列のサンプルポイントの数」に「3」を入力します。
  • 「計算」ボタンをクリックします。

3つの数字の組み合わせはいくつありますか?

ご覧のとおり、 3桁を配置する方法は3 x 2 x 1 = 6つあります。したがって、720の可能性のそのセットでは、 3桁のそれぞれの一意の組み合わせが6回表されます。

6つの数字の組み合わせはいくつありますか?

それらは100万個あります(999999 + 1)。繰り返しが許可されていない場合(おそらく最後の文で参照しているものです)、最初の数字に10桁のいずれかを選択し、2番目の数字に残りの9桁のいずれかを選択できます。これは、10 x 9 x 8 x 7 x 6 x5または151,200です。

5つの数字の組み合わせはいくつありますか?

5桁の組み合わせの数は、10 5 = 100,000。つまり、99,999より1つ多くなります。一般化すると、N桁の組み合わせの数は10Nになります。ここで、これは00000または00534を「 5桁の数字」として数えることを前提としています。

考えられるすべての結果をどのように見つけますか?

可能な結果の総数は6、3∙2 = 6です。この原則は基本的なカウントの原則と呼ばれ、ルールは次のとおりです。イベントx(この場合は鶏肉、牛肉、野菜)がx通りに発生する可能性がある場合。そして、イベントy(この場合はフライドポテトまたはマッシュポテト)はyの方法で発生する可能性があります。

順列と組み合わせの違いは何ですか?

組み合わせ順列違いは順序付けです。順列では要素の順序を気にしますが、組み合わせでは気にしません。たとえば、ロッカーの「コンボ」が5432であるとします。ロッカーに4325を入力すると、順序が異なるため(順列とも呼ばれます)、ロッカーは開きません。

どのように順列を作成しますか?

順列を生成するためのヒープのアルゴリズム
  1. アルゴリズムは(n-1)を生成します!
  2. nが奇数の場合は、最初と最後の要素を交換し、nが偶数の場合は、i番目の要素(iは0から始まるカウンター)と最後の要素を交換し、iがn未満になるまで上記のアルゴリズムを繰り返します。

Pythonで文字列のすべての組み合わせを取得するにはどうすればよいですか?

特定の文字列のすべての可能な順列見つけるには、順列(iterable [、r])と呼ばれる便利なメソッドを持つitertoolsモジュールを使用できます。このメソッドは、反復可能オブジェクト内の要素の連続するr長の順列をタプルとして返します。

2つの数字の組み合わせはいくつありますか?

2つの数値がある場合、組み合わせごとに2つの順列があります。 / 2 = 1225 2450:組み合わせあたりの順列ので可能な順列を分割します。

Excelで4つの数字の組み合わせをどのように見つけますか?

Excelでは、空白のセルを選択して9までの数0のすべての可能な4桁の数字の組み合わせを一覧表示するには以下の式を使用することができますし、それには、この式= TEXT(ROW(A1)-1、「0000」)を入力し、Enterキーを押します次に、 4桁の組み合わせすべて表示されるまで、オートフィルハンドルを下にドラッグします。

39の数字の組み合わせはいくつありますか?

ご注文に含まれるもの:すべての可能な5/39番号の組み合わせ。合計の組み合わせ-575,757。

繰り返さずに4つの数字の組み合わせはいくつありますか?

回答と説明:
繰り返しなし4つの数字との可能な組み合わせは15です。